Product Manager pay in United States, after tax

A Product Manager in United States earns a median of about $130,000 gross. After US income tax and contributions, that works out to roughly $7,677 a month in take-home, with 29.1% of the salary going to tax and contributions.

At this income the marginal rate in United States is about 24%, so a pay rise, bonus or move into a senior Product Manager role is taxed at that rate on the extra earnings โ€” useful to know when you weigh up the next step.
